Even those who are privately insured are experiencing financial strain due to the rising costs of health care coverage.

Published Date: 29 May 2024

The percentage of Americans without health insurance fell to a record low of 8% by 2022. Over 50% of U.S. s. private health insurance covered an estimated 180 million people, or 55% of the population.
